H2: Decoding SEO APIs: Your Gateway to Data-Driven Strategies (Explainer & Practical Tips)
SEO APIs are the unsung heroes behind sophisticated search engine optimization. Think of them as direct pipelines to vast datasets, allowing you to programmatically access information that would be impossible to gather manually. These aren't just for developers; they are powerful tools for any SEO professional looking to elevate their strategy beyond basic analytics. By integrating with platforms like Google Search Console, Google Analytics, or third-party tools like Ahrefs and SEMrush, APIs provide raw data on everything from keyword rankings and backlink profiles to organic traffic and competitor performance. This granular access empowers you to build custom dashboards, automate reporting, and even develop proprietary tools tailored precisely to your unique SEO challenges. Understanding how to leverage these programmatic interfaces is no longer a niche skill; it's a fundamental requirement for anyone serious about data-driven SEO success.
The practical applications of SEO APIs are incredibly diverse and impactful. Instead of spending hours manually exporting and compiling data, imagine a script that automatically pulls daily keyword rankings for your top 100 terms, cross-referencing them with competitor positions and sending you an alert for significant shifts. Or consider building an automated backlink audit system that flags new toxic links immediately. Here are just a few ways you can practically apply them:
- Automated Reporting: Generate custom, scheduled reports combining data from multiple sources.
- Competitor Analysis: Programmatically track competitor keyword performance, backlink growth, and content gaps.
- Content Auditing: Identify underperforming content based on real-time traffic and ranking data.
- Keyword Research: Uncover new keyword opportunities and track their performance at scale.
By moving beyond manual data extraction, SEO APIs allow you to shift your focus from data gathering to strategic analysis and actionable insights, ultimately driving more effective and efficient SEO campaigns.
